コンテナーの IOleInPlaceSite、IOleInPlaceSiteEx、または IOleInPlaceSiteWindowless の各インターフェイス ポインターへのポインターです。
CComPtr<IOleInPlaceSiteWindowless> m_spInPlaceSite;
解説
注意
このデータ メンバーをコントロール クラス内で使用するには、コントロール クラスでデータ メンバーとして宣言する必要があります。 このデータ メンバーは、基本クラスの共用体で宣言されているため、コントロール クラスには継承されません。
m_spInPlaceSite ポインターは m_bNegotiatedWnd フラグが TRUE の場合のみ有効です。
m_bWndLess データ メンバー フラグと m_bInPlaceSiteEx データ メンバー フラグに対応する m_spInPlaceSite のポインター型を次の表に示します。
m_spInPlaceSite の型 |
m_bWndless の値 |
m_bInPlaceSiteEx の値 |
---|---|---|
IOleInPlaceSiteWindowless |
TRUE |
TRUE または FALSE |
IOleInPlaceSiteEx |
FALSE |
TRUE |
IOleInPlaceSite |
FALSE |
FALSE |
必要条件
**ヘッダー:**atlctl.h